📅 When to Watch
Premiere Date and Time Slot
Mark your calendars! NCIS: Origins Season 2 is expected to premiere in Fall 2025, with Tuesday night slots alongside the flagship NCIS and NCIS: Sydney—making it a triple NCIS night for CBS fans.
🔗 Canon Tie-Ins and Easter Eggs
What Long-Time Fans Will Love
-
Mike Franks’s brother Mason shows up—referencing a decades-old NCIS line.
-
The Fed 5 storyline resurfaces, tying NCIS: Origins to both NCIS: New Orleans and past Gibbs mythology.
-
Gibbs’s future relationships, including his marriage to Diane, are explored with emotional precision.

Q3: Is Mark Harmon returning on-screen?
A: Not yet. He continues to narrate the series and is heavily involved behind the scenes as executive producer.
